For gaming, try bazzite, cachyOS, or nobara. Mint is also good, but might not have latest and greatest drivers or kernel etc, even then it is very popular.
I switched to mint and then to nobara early last year and love it.
I tested a few on VMware in windows before taking the leap. 3 months ago I wiped my windows partition coz I hadn't used it in yonks.
